The XPS 3000 also runs the Visao[R] High-Speed Otologic Drill, allowing increased surgical visibility and access with patent-pending, 20[degrees]-curved burs. Offering 80,000 rpm forward and reverse operation, the Visao drill provides power in debulking and finesse in delicate procedures with virtually no start-up "kick."
